This textbook introduces the reader to
Autodesk Inventor 11, the world's leading parametric solid modeling
software. In this textbook, the author emphasizes on the solid modeling
techniques that improve the productivity and efficiency of the user. Also,
the chapters are structured in a pedagogical sequence that makes this
textbook very effective in learning the features and capabilities of the
software. The following are some additional useful features of this book.
This textbook consists of 15
pedagogically sequenced chapters covering the Part, Assembly, Drafting,
Presentation, Sheet Metal, and Weldment environments of Autodesk Inventor
11. Every chapter begins with a command section that provides detailed
explanation of the commands and tools in Autodesk Inventor 11. The command
section is followed by tutorials that are created using these commands.
This approach allows the user to use this textbook initially as a learning
tool and then later use it as a reference material. �
